nsc_bar_plugin_configs A

Total Complexity 52
Dependencies 4
Dependents 8
Total lines 248
Lines of code 190
Logical lines of code 115
Comment lines 5
Methods 20
Properties 4

Methods 20

Method Rating Maintainability Complexity Lines of code
nsc_bar_get_option()
S
56 6 17
add_current_setting_values()
S
52 5 23
getConsentCookieName()
S
60 4 15
add_bannersettings_json()
S
61 4 12
get_tab_description_tipps_template()
S
61 4 12
return_settings_field()
S
62 4 11
set_settings_as_object()
S
59 3 14
nsc_bar_return_plugin_settings_without_db_settings()
S
66 3 9
nsc_bar_isPremiumAddOnInstalled()
S
69 2 7
add_html_description_templates()
S
67 2 7
get_active_tab()
S
67 2 8
getLastArrayEntry()
S
68 2 8
nsc_bar_return_plugin_settings()
S
66 2 9
nsc_bar_new_banner_enabled()
S
67 2 8
nsc_bar_plugin_activation()
S
70 2 6
nsc_bar_replace_variables_in_config()
S
69 1 6
nsc_bar_return_settings_field_default_value()
S
76 1 4
nsc_bar_update_option()
S
72 1 5
nsc_bar_plugin_prefix()
S
77 1 4
nsc_bar_delete_option()
S
73 1 5